* [PATCH] net/mlx5/hws: fix TIR action support in FDB
@ 2025-08-14 13:20 Dariusz Sosnowski
2025-08-15 15:21 ` Patrick Robb
0 siblings, 1 reply; 2+ messages in thread
From: Dariusz Sosnowski @ 2025-08-14 13:20 UTC (permalink / raw)
To: Viacheslav Ovsiienko, Bing Zhao, Ori Kam, Suanming Mou,
Matan Azrad, Alex Vesker, Erez Shitrit
Cc: dev, stable
TIR action was not added as an allowed action in FDB domain.
This prevented the usage of RSS flow action in transfer flow rules
with HW Steering flow engine.
Fixes: 1f8fc88d4d31 ("net/mlx5/hws: allow jump to TIR over FDB")
Cc: valex@nvidia.com
Cc: stable@dpdk.org
Signed-off-by: Dariusz Sosnowski <dsosnowski@nvidia.com>
Acked-by: Bing Zhao <bingz@nvidia.com>
Acked-by: Suanming Mou <suanmingm@nvidia.com>
---
drivers/net/mlx5/hws/mlx5dr_action.c | 1 +
1 file changed, 1 insertion(+)
diff --git a/drivers/net/mlx5/hws/mlx5dr_action.c b/drivers/net/mlx5/hws/mlx5dr_action.c
index c1c6d28ac4..d765d57a8f 100644
--- a/drivers/net/mlx5/hws/mlx5dr_action.c
+++ b/drivers/net/mlx5/hws/mlx5dr_action.c
@@ -94,6 +94,7 @@ static const uint32_t action_order_arr[MLX5DR_TABLE_TYPE_MAX][MLX5DR_ACTION_TYP_
BIT(MLX5DR_ACTION_TYP_REFORMAT_L2_TO_TNL_L3),
BIT(MLX5DR_ACTION_TYP_TBL) |
BIT(MLX5DR_ACTION_TYP_MISS) |
+ BIT(MLX5DR_ACTION_TYP_TIR) |
BIT(MLX5DR_ACTION_TYP_VPORT) |
BIT(MLX5DR_ACTION_TYP_DROP) |
BIT(MLX5DR_ACTION_TYP_DEST_ROOT) |
--
2.39.5
^ permalink raw reply [flat|nested] 2+ messages in thread
* Re: [PATCH] net/mlx5/hws: fix TIR action support in FDB
2025-08-14 13:20 [PATCH] net/mlx5/hws: fix TIR action support in FDB Dariusz Sosnowski
@ 2025-08-15 15:21 ` Patrick Robb
0 siblings, 0 replies; 2+ messages in thread
From: Patrick Robb @ 2025-08-15 15:21 UTC (permalink / raw)
To: Dariusz Sosnowski
Cc: Viacheslav Ovsiienko, Bing Zhao, Ori Kam, Suanming Mou,
Matan Azrad, Alex Vesker, Erez Shitrit, dev, stable
[-- Attachment #1: Type: text/plain, Size: 1452 bytes --]
Sending a CI testing retest for this series because of a suspected false
failure on the packet capture testsuite.
On Thu, Aug 14, 2025 at 9:22 AM Dariusz Sosnowski <dsosnowski@nvidia.com>
wrote:
> TIR action was not added as an allowed action in FDB domain.
> This prevented the usage of RSS flow action in transfer flow rules
> with HW Steering flow engine.
>
> Fixes: 1f8fc88d4d31 ("net/mlx5/hws: allow jump to TIR over FDB")
> Cc: valex@nvidia.com
> Cc: stable@dpdk.org
>
> Signed-off-by: Dariusz Sosnowski <dsosnowski@nvidia.com>
> Acked-by: Bing Zhao <bingz@nvidia.com>
> Acked-by: Suanming Mou <suanmingm@nvidia.com>
> ---
> drivers/net/mlx5/hws/mlx5dr_action.c | 1 +
> 1 file changed, 1 insertion(+)
>
> diff --git a/drivers/net/mlx5/hws/mlx5dr_action.c
> b/drivers/net/mlx5/hws/mlx5dr_action.c
> index c1c6d28ac4..d765d57a8f 100644
> --- a/drivers/net/mlx5/hws/mlx5dr_action.c
> +++ b/drivers/net/mlx5/hws/mlx5dr_action.c
> @@ -94,6 +94,7 @@ static const uint32_t
> action_order_arr[MLX5DR_TABLE_TYPE_MAX][MLX5DR_ACTION_TYP_
> BIT(MLX5DR_ACTION_TYP_REFORMAT_L2_TO_TNL_L3),
> BIT(MLX5DR_ACTION_TYP_TBL) |
> BIT(MLX5DR_ACTION_TYP_MISS) |
> + BIT(MLX5DR_ACTION_TYP_TIR) |
> BIT(MLX5DR_ACTION_TYP_VPORT) |
> BIT(MLX5DR_ACTION_TYP_DROP) |
> BIT(MLX5DR_ACTION_TYP_DEST_ROOT) |
> --
> 2.39.5
>
>
[-- Attachment #2: Type: text/html, Size: 2169 bytes --]
^ permalink raw reply [flat|nested] 2+ messages in thread
end of thread, other threads:[~2025-08-15 15:28 UTC | newest]
Thread overview: 2+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2025-08-14 13:20 [PATCH] net/mlx5/hws: fix TIR action support in FDB Dariusz Sosnowski
2025-08-15 15:21 ` Patrick Robb
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).